In the aftermath of the acquittal of Baltimore Police Officer Caesar Goodson Jr, the van driver in the case of the death of Freddie Gray, we discuss the way the system is set up against black people on many different levels. We also discuss the Supreme Court's latest recent weakening of the 4th Amendment and their recent defense of affirmative action. Originally aired 06/27/2016 on WOLB 1010 AM Baltimore.
